Publisher's Synopsis

This book on the extraordinarily fast-growing numbers of New Age Travellers allows them to explain in their own words why they reject more conventional lifestyles, how they survive and why they are so committed to life on the road . William Shaw and Richard Lowe analyse the compulsion to opt out of conventional society, detail the reality of constantly moving on and balance the picture with interviews with travellers' parents, social workers, police officers, traditional gypsies and others whose lives have been affected by this disturbing new social phenomenon. Interviews with some of the liveliest individuals amongst the Travellers also include their most popular band, The Levellers.
